12 Dunmore Holiday Villas, Dunmore East, Co Waterford

Retention of a roof light and permission for a single-storey rear extension and side shed.

The application seeks retention of an existing side roof light on a detached house. It also requests permission for a single-storey rear extension, a lean-to side shed, new roof lights, a new rear bedroom window, and a front boundary fence.
